Detailed Technical Breakdown
The XI 9 20 is engineered for one primary purpose: to excel in a vertical, stationary fishing environment. Unlike transom-mount transducers designed for moving boats, the XI 9 20 provides the specific sonar functionality needed for ice fishing.
-
Sonar Technology: The transducer operates on Humminbird's proven Dual Beam sonar technology. This gives the angler two distinct views of the water column:
- 200 kHz Narrow Beam (20° cone angle): This is your precision beam. It provides the highest target resolution, making it ideal for distinguishing individual fish, seeing your jig, and identifying fish that are tight to the bottom. This is the go-to beam for active jigging.
- 83 kHz Wide Beam (60° cone angle): This beam offers three times the coverage area of the narrow beam. It's perfect for searching a new spot to see if any fish are in the vicinity or for tracking a fish that moves just outside the narrow cone.
-
Construction: The unit is built to withstand the harsh realities of ice fishing. The transducer body is robust, and the 8-foot cable is specifically chosen for its shorter length, which prevents tangles and clutter in a confined ice shack or around your hole. The included foam float is essential for suspending the transducer just below the ice surface, keeping it level and protected.
Please Note: This transducer does not have a built-in temperature sensor, as surface temperature is not a relevant data point for ice fishing. It also does not support CHIRP, Down Imaging (DI), or Side Imaging (SI) technologies. It is a dedicated 2D sonar transducer.
Models Used On: An Extensive Compatibility List
The XI 9 20 Ice Transducer is one of Humminbird's most versatile accessories, designed to be compatible with a vast number of past and present fish finder models, especially those without CHIRP sonar capabilities. To use this transducer, compatible HELIX models must be set to "Ice Fishing Mode" in the menu.
This transducer is the ideal choice for converting the following types of units for ice fishing:
-
First Generation ICE HELIX Models (Non-CHIRP): The original ICE HELIX units were designed around this transducer's technology.
-
Non-CHIRP HELIX Models:
- HELIX 5 Sonar G2, HELIX 5 Sonar GPS G2
- HELIX 7 Sonar G2, HELIX 7 Sonar GPS G2
- First-generation HELIX 5 and HELIX 7 models
-
Legacy Model Series (Non-DI/SI): This transducer is broadly compatible with a huge range of older Humminbird units, making it a perfect way to give them a new life on the ice. This includes, but is not limited to:
- 100 Series: (e.g., 141c, 161)
- 300 Series: (e.g., 323, 343c, 363, 383c)
- 500 Series: (e.g., 550, 565, 570, 595c, 597ci)
- 600 Series: (e.g., 678c, 688ci)
- 700 Series: (e.g., 718, 728, 788ci)
- 800 Series: (e.g., 859ci)
- 900 Series: (e.g., 959ci)
- 1100 Series: (e.g., 1159ci)
- Matrix Series: (e.g., Matrix 17, 27, 87c)
Important Compatibility Note: While the XI 9 20 will physically connect to and function with many CHIRP-enabled and Down Imaging (DI) units, it will only provide traditional 2D sonar returns. You will not get the benefits of CHIRP sonar, and the DI functions will not work. For CHIRP-enabled units (HELIX G2N and newer), the recommended transducer for optimal performance is the Humminbird XI 9 1521.
